Osho Quotes on
Ecstasy
-
The whole art of meditation
is, how to leave the personality easily, move to
the center, and be not a person. Just to be and
not be a person is the whole art of meditation,
the whole art of inner ecstasy.
-
The whole art of ecstasy,
meditation, samadhi, is: How to become one with
the rhythm of the universe. When it exhales, you
exhale. When it inhales, you inhale. You live in
it, are not separate, are one with it.
-
The mind is the world and
the no-mind is freedom from the world. The mind
is misery and no-mind is the end of misery and
the beginning of ecstasy.
-
There is no other greater
ecstasy, no other greater blissfulness, than to
know who you are. To know the inner space is to
know all. It is unlimited silence but not dead,
it is alive with songs of its own, with dances
of its own.
-
The word 'ecstasy' is
beautiful; it simply means "standing out." Out
of what? Standing out of your ego, your
personality, your mind; getting out of the whole
structure in which you have lived -- not only
lived but with which you have become identified.
Standing out of all this, just a pure witness, a
watcher on the hills -- and everything is left
deep down in the valley.
-
Meditation means getting
out of the mind, looking at the mind from the
outside. That's exactly the meaning of the word
'ecstasy': to stand out. To stand out of the
mind makes you ecstatic, brings bliss to you.
And great intelligence is released. When you are
identified with the mind you cannot be very
intelligent because you become identified with
an instrument, you become confined by the
instrument and its limitations. And you are
unlimited -- you are consciousness.
-
Meditation is not your
doing. You simply make the effort, but it is not
your doing. Your effort is needed to prepare the
ground. As the ground is ready, immediately you
see you are no more; the whole cosmos is. You
have entered a greater womb, an eternal womb of
tremendous peace and ecstasy.
-
Meditation is the technique
of inner conquest -- and that is the real
challenge. Those who have any guts should accept
the inner challenge. It is easy to reach the
moon, it is easy to reach Everest; it is far
more difficult to reach your own centre. But the
moment you reach it all ecstasy is yours, and
forever and forever. You attain to a bliss which
cannot be taken away from you.
-
Go inwards. Find your inner
space, and suddenly, you will find an explosion
of light, of beauty, of ecstasy -- as if
suddenly thousands of roses have blossomed
within you and you are full of their fragrance.
-
Begin with dhyana, with
meditation, and end in samadhi, in ecstasy, and
you will know what God is. It is not a
hypothesis, it is an experience. You have to
LIVE it -- that is the only way to know it.
-
Meditation is the art of
living with yourself. It is nothing else than
that, simply that: the art of being joyously
alone. A meditator can sit joyously alone for
months, for years. He does not hanker for the
other, because his own inner ecstasy is so much,
is so overpowering, that who bothers about the
other?
-
Just one quality of the
buddha has to be remembered. He consists only of
one quality: witnessing.
This small word `witnessing' contains the whole
of spirituality.
Witness that you are not the body.
Witness that you are not the mind.
Witness that you are only a witness.
As the witnessing deepens, you start becoming
drunk with the divine. This is what is called
ecstasy.
-
Existence is only in the
present. Mind is never in the present. In fact,
the moment you are in the present, there is no
mind in you, there is great silence. The whole
sky of your inner being is without thoughts,
without clouds. I call this the state of
no-mind. Only in this state of no-mind do you
meet existence. And that meeting is the ultimate
ecstasy. Once you have tasted it, you will never
bother about the future.
-
Awareness, beholding the
mind, is the most essential method to have a
breakthrough. And once you have gone just a step
beyond the mind, you have entered the world of
nirvana, you have entered the world of light and
eternal life. You have attained to spiritual
integrity, freedom, and tremendous ecstasy which
the mind cannot even dream about.
-
Unless you come out of your
mind and become a no-mind you will not know what
life is all about, you will live in vain. You
will not have your honeymoon, it is impossible.
You will not know the sweetness that existence
is full of and the ecstasy.
-
Meditation has to spread
all over your life. Whatsoever you do, do
meditatively. Walk meditatively, eat
meditatively. If you are making love, make love
meditatively. Meditation has to become your life
twenty-four hours a day; then only the
transformation. Then you go beyond sex, you go
beyond body, you go beyond mind. And for the
first time you become aware of godliness, of
ecstasy, of bliss, of truth, of liberation.
